Middle Frontend Developer

28 березня 2022

Вимоги: frontend
communicate api javascript html5 css scrum mobile react reading solid writing functional html canvas svg node.js redux jest webpack http rest apis creative english
Англійська: eng: Не важно

Memcrab has been successfully creating web and mobile solutions for over 12 years. Our projects are nonstandard and compelling. We deliver complex and turnkey solutions to our customers from the USA, Europe, and Asia. Our team is growing and we are looking for new talents to join us.


  • Plan, describe and estimate tasks' technical part from business description
  • Communicate with part of a team, that is responsible for API, plan data structures
  • Implement the development of a modern, single-page application using — JavaScript, HTML5, and CSS as a member of the Scrum team
  • Mobile application development based on React Native
  • Ensure the quality of the product in a highly regulated environment utilizing automated testing
  • Work on challenging software architecture
  • Meet high safety requirements
  • Educate yourself and your colleagues by regularly collaborating with the Scrum team


  • Asking the right questions while working with business requirements tasks
  • Reading others' code, doing the code review
  • Systematically developing the product with a technical perspective
  • Solid expertise in building modern, responsive web applications
  • Experience with server-side rendering and caching
  • Knowledge of algorithms and computational complexity
  • Good understanding of browser performance and memory constraints
  • Writing simple, clean, testable and pragmatic code
  • Functional programming experience


  • Excellent knowledge of JavaScript (ES 2016+), HTML, CSS, Canvas (without webGL), SVG and React (included latest releases)
  • Good knowledge of available browsers' API and React Native, Node.js for building simple API
  • Experience with Redux, Flow.js, Jest, Webpack
  • Understanding HTTP, REST APIs, and other basic principles


  • Working in a team that can handle any tech challenges
  • Creative freedom and possibility to influence the product.
  • Young and the friendly team willing to share their knowledge and cookies.
  • Non-bureaucratic corporate culture.
  • Working hours: Mon-Fri from 9:00 a.m. to 6:00 p.m. Flexible working hours are possible if necessary.
  • Paid vacation, sick leaves and national holidays.
  • Variety of perks in the office (coffee from our barista, tea and cookies, Playstation, etc.).
  • Corporate English speaking club.
  • We offer internal and specialized training.